We just returned from a weeks stay and had a really nice time. We exchanged into Sabal Palms but were a little nervous based on some of the older reviews. Our place had a great view overlooking a pond and golf course. The grounds were well maintained and overall the property was neat and clean. The unit was a nice... more

USed 150K Marriott points to stay in a 2 bedroom unit. Everything was great except the tvs needed to be upgraded and you need conditioners in the room (only shampoo). The pool in the timeshare is nice enough and great for young kids - goes from 3 feet to 5 feet. We never ventured to main pool as we had... more

My family of 5 recently stayed in a 2 bedroom condo at Sabal Palms and we couldn't have asked for more. The condo is spacious and well laid out. The kitchen and bathrooms are upgraded (the master bath has an awesome shower with a rain showerhead and wall jets) and the living room/dining room gave us plenty of room to... more

Three generations stayed in a villa for spring break, and had a great time. Usually with 2 little kids we start to feel closed in, even in an extended stay hotel, but the villas at Sabal Palms are huge. The large screened porch is a nice plus. Our unit seemed to be updated with the exception of the guest bathroom.... more
